Output 8e944d0bff7667a4911491fd0a66cde710c4a40228809269f6f79f53decd0b33:4

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949d05b527de1aae22891a03417755fa60532137 OP_EQUAL
address
3FEp32z2tsSmQ9wYwtizh4iAo4VT1RLNgs
transaction
8e944d0bff7667a4911491fd0a66cde710c4a40228809269f6f79f53decd0b33
spent
true